1.1 Getting Started with Power Query
Before diving into the intricacies of Power Query, let’s first understand how to access and enable this remarkable add-in. To activate Power Query, follow these steps:
- Open Excel and click on the “Data” tab in the Ribbon.
- Locate the “Get & Transform Data” group and choose “Get Data”.
- Select the data source of your choice, such as a file, database, or online service.
- Power Query will guide you through the process of connecting to and importing the data.

2.1 Filtering Data with Power Query
Filtering is an integral part of data analysis. With Power Query, you can apply various filtering techniques to focus on specific subsets of data. By understanding and utilizing Power Query’s filtering capabilities, you can revolutionize your data analysis workflow.
One of the most common filtering techniques is using the “Filter Rows” transformation. This function allows you to specify filtering criteria based on column values, enabling you to extract the desired subset of data.
2.2 Combining and Merging Data Tables
Power Query enables seamless integration of multiple data tables, making it easier to analyze intricate relationships between different datasets. Whether you need to merge tables based on common columns or append data vertically, Power Query offers a versatile set of tools to accomplish your goals.
The “Merge Queries” function allows you to consolidate data from multiple tables based on shared columns, creating a unified dataset that captures the interconnectedness of your data sources.
2.3 Transforming Data with Custom Functions
Custom functions in Power Query provide an opportunity to perform complex calculations or manipulations on your data. These functions allow for flexibility and automation, helping you save time and effort in data transformation tasks.
By writing your own custom functions using the M formula language, you can unlock a world of possibilities within Power Query. From manipulating text strings to performing intricate calculations, custom functions expand the capabilities of your data analysis toolkit.
